import sys
import argparse
import itertools
def generate_wordlist(words, combination_length=None, verbose=False):
"""
Generate all possible combinations of the given words with specified length.
Args:
words (list): List of words
combination_length (int): Length of combined words (default: None)
verbose (bool): Flag to enable verbose output (default: False)
Returns:
list: List of all combinations of the given words with specified length
"""
if combination_length is None:
combinations = []
for length in range(1, len(words) + 1):
combinations.extend(generate_wordlist(words, length, verbose))
return combinations
wordlist = []
total_combinations = len(list(itertools.combinations(words, combination_length)))
for i, combination in enumerate(itertools.combinations(words, combination_length), start=1):
if not verbose:
sys.stdout.write(f"\rGenerated {i}/{total_combinations} combinations")
sys.stdout.flush()
if verbose:
print(f"Generating combination {i}/{total_combinations}: {' '.join(combination)}")
wordlist.extend([''.join(comb) for comb in itertools.permutations(combination)])
if not verbose:
print("\nGeneration completed.")
return wordlist
def save_wordlist_to_file(wordlist, filename, verbose=False):
"""
Save the wordlist to a file.
Args:
wordlist (list): List of words
filename (str): Name of the file to save the wordlist
verbose (bool): Flag to enable verbose output (default: False)
"""
with open(filename, 'w') as file:
for i, word in enumerate(wordlist, start=1):
file.write(word + '\n')
if verbose:
print(f"Saved {i} words to {filename}", end='\r')
if verbose:
print(f"Saved all {len(wordlist)} words to {filename}")
def main(args):
"""
Main function to execute the program.
"""
parser = argparse.ArgumentParser(description="Generate a wordlist and save it to a file.")
parser.add_argument("filename", help="Name of the file to save the wordlist")
parser.add_argument("-l", "--length", type=int, default=None, help="Length of combined words (default: None)")
parser.add_argument("-v", "--verbose", action="store_true", help="Enable verbose output")
parser.add_argument("words", nargs="+", help="List of words")
args = parser.parse_args(args)
if not args.words:
print("Error: No words provided.")
return
if args.length is not None and args.length <= 0:
print("Error: Invalid length of combined words. Length should be greater than 0.")
return
wordlist = generate_wordlist(args.words, args.length, args.verbose)
save_wordlist_to_file(wordlist, args.filename, args.verbose)
print("Wordlist saved to", args.filename)
if not args.verbose:
print("Number of passwords generated:", len(wordlist))
if __name__ == "__main__":
main(sys.argv[1:])
